Hi Dion,

What exactly is an alias? Would it be some sort of Jelly feature where the same class 
could be used by different tags? If so, it would work only after fixing JELLY-98.

Anyway, for the end-user (i.e., people using Jelly tags), I think these alias are 
fine. But from the developer point of view (i.e., people implementing Core tags or 
using Core classes when creating other Jelly tags), it would be nicer if we follow the 
JSTL way and create an abstract LoopTagSupport class, and then ForEachTag and 
ForTokensTag would extend that class.

Description:
It would be really nice if there was a ForTokensTag on Core.

I know you can obtain the same result using a util:tokenizer and core:forEach combo, 
but that's not trivial for those with JSTL experience.

So, if you are fine with that, I can implement such tag and submit it as a patch.
